Latest Patents
Eckelmann holds a patent for a "Detection method for volleyball function." This invention involves an electronic apparatus that includes a case containing an electronic module powered by a means of storing electrical energy. The electronic module features a calculation unit connected to an accelerator sensor and a memory unit. Additionally, it is linked to a display means to present information related to the data from the accelerator sensor. This patent showcases his expertise in integrating technology with sports.
